Subject: Claas 3300 square baler?


West central Ohio
Anyone here running one? How do they compare to the other brands- Massey, Krone, NH? Currently running a 4790 Hesston, while its a good, simple baler, its starting to get tired. How big of a learning curve going from an older baler to a newer one? How's the single knotter? Hydraulic stuffer? Reliability and longevity? How many ponies with the roto cut? Currently using a 200 magnum with cvt tranny. I've heard these new balers can really gobble up the power. Could use a 275 if needed, but really like the cvt for baling. What kind of bale weights could a person expect making 8' bales in wheat straw?
